Abstract

The invention relates to a method for preparing a sulphoxide compound of formula (I) either as a single enantiomer or in an enantiomerically enriched form, comprising the steps of: a) contacting a pro-chiral sulphide of formula (II) with a metal chiral complex, a base and an oxidizing agent in an organic solvent; and optionally b) isolating the obtained sulphoxide of formula (I). wherein n, Y, R 1 , R 1a , R 2 and R 2a are as defined in claim 1.

Claims (53)

1. A method for preparing a sulphoxide compound of formula (I) either as a single enantiomer or in an enantiomerically enriched form:

wherein:

Y is —C(═O)X wherein X is —OR 5 ;

R1, R1 a , R2 and R2 a are each independently H, halo, (C1-C8)alkyl, (C2-C8)alkenyl, (C2-C8)alkynyl, (C 6 -C 10 )aryl, —CN, —CF 3 , —NO 2 , —OH, (C1-C8)alkoxy, —O(CH 2 ) m NR 6 R 7 , —OC(═O)R 8 , —C(═O)OR 8 , —C(═O)R 8 , —OC(═O)NR 6 R 7 , —O(CH 2 ) m OR 8 , —(CH 2 ) m OR 8 , —NR 6 R 7 , or —C(═O)NR 6 R 7 ;

R5 is alkyl, cycloalkyl, aralkyl, alkaryl, or aryl;

R6 and R7 are each independently H, (C1-C6) alkyl, or hydroxy(C1-C6)alkyl;

R8 is H, alkyl, cycloalkyl, aralkyl, alkaryl, or aryl;

n is 1, 2 or 3; and

m is 1, 2, 3, or 4;

comprising the steps of:

a) contacting a pro-chiral sulphide of formula (II):

wherein R1, R2, R1 a , R2 a , Y, and n are as defined above,

with a metal chiral ligand complex, a base, and an oxidizing agent in an organic solvent, for a time and under conditions effective to produce the sulphoxide of formula I; and optionally

b) isolating the sulphoxide of formula (I);

wherein said metal chiral ligand complex is selected from the group consisting of C 2 -symmetric diol titanium (IV) complexes, C 3 -symmetric trialkanolamine titanium (IV) complexes, C 3 -symmetric trialkanolamine zirconium (IV) complexes, chiral (salen) manganese (III) complexes, and chiral (salen) vanadium (IV) complexes.

2. The method according to claim 1 , wherein R 1 , R 2 , R 1a and R 2a are each H.

3. The method according to claim 1 , wherein n is 1.

4.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the metal chiral ligand complex is selected from the group consisting of C 2 -symmetric diol titanium(IV) complexes and C 3 -symmetric trialkanolamine titanium(IV) complexes.

5. The method according to claim 4 , wherein the metal chiral ligand is diethyltartrate titanium(IV) complex.

6.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the metal chiral complex is prepared from a metal compound, a chiral ligand, and water.

7. The method according to claim 6 , wherein the metal chiral ligand complex is prepared with 0.1-1 equivalent of water, with respect to the metal compound.

8. The method according to claim 7 , wherein the metal chiral ligand complex is prepared with 0.4-0.8 equivalent of water, with respect to the metal compound.

9.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the base is a tertiary amine.

10. The method according to claim 9 , wherein the tertiary amine is diisopropylethylamine or triethylamine.

11. The method according to claim 1 , wherein step a) is performed in the presence of 0.01 to 2 equivalents of base, with respect to the sulphide.

12. The method according to claim 11 , wherein step a) is performed in presence of 0.05-0.5 equivalents of base, with respect to the sulphide.

13. The method according to claim 12 , wherein step a) is performed in the presence of 0.1 to 0.3 equivalents of base, with respect to the sulphide.

14. The method according to claim 1 , wherein step a) is performed in the presence of 0.05-0.5 equivalents of the metal chiral ligand complex, with respect to the sulphide.

15. The method according to claim 14 , wherein step a) is performed in the presence of 0.1-0.3 equivalents of the metal chiral ligand complex, with respect to the sulphide.

16.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the metal chiral ligand complex is prepared at a temperature between 20-70° C.

17. The method according to claim 16 , wherein the metal chiral ligand complex is prepared at a temperature between 40-60° C.

18. The method according to claim 17 , wherein the metal chiral ligand complex is prepared at a temperature between 50-55° C.

19.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the sulphide is contacted with the metal chiral ligand complex, the base, and the oxidizing agent at a temperature between 0-60° C.

20. The method according to claim 19 , wherein the sulphide is contacted with the metal chiral ligand complex, the base, and the oxidizing agent at room temperature.

21.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the oxidizing agent is hydrogen peroxide, tert-butyl hydroperoxide, or cumene hydroperoxide.

22. The method according to claim 21 , wherein the oxidizing agent is cumene hydroperoxide.

23.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the sulphoxide is isolated by filtration.

24.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the method further comprises a step of crystallization of the sulphoxide obtained in step b).

25. The method according to claim 24 , wherein the crystallization is carried out in a mixture of an organic solvent and water.

26. The method according to claim 25 , wherein the organic solvent is an alcohol.

27. The method according to claim 25 , wherein the water represents up to 40% by volume of the mixture.

28. The method according to claim 24 , wherein the crystallization is a preferential crystallization.

29.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the sulphoxide compound of formula (I) is an ester of modafinic acid.

30. The method according to claim 29 , which further comprises a step of converting X=—OR 5 of the sulphoxide of formula (I) into X=—NH 2 .

31. The method according to claim 30 , wherein X=—OR 5 of the sulphoxide of formula (I) is converted into X=—NH 2 by an amidation reaction.

32.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the compound of formula (II) is methyldiphenylmethylthioacetate:

33. The method according to claim 32 , wherein the compound of formula (II) is prepared from benzhydrol:

34. The method according to claim 33 , wherein the methyldiphenylmethylthioacetate is prepared from benzhydrol by the method comprising the steps of:

i) conversion of benzhydrol into benzhydryl acetate, and

ii) conversion of benzhydryl acetate into methyldiphenylmethylthioacetate.

35. The method of claim 1 wherein the sulphoxide of formula (I) is produced with an enantiomeric excess of more than about 80%.

36. The method of claim 1 wherein the sulphoxide of formula (I) is produced with an enantiomeric excess of more than about 90%.

37. The method of claim 1 wherein the sulphoxide of formula (I) is produced with an enantiomeric excess of more than about 98%.
